Hi ,

I might be wrong , but I remember that if you use the old version firmware of the ICOM-A and set up your network within a DHCP network , than the Program32(SSS) will sees the ICOM .

Please excuse me for am not 100% sure what the latest version that's compatible with the SSS , I figure it's the v3.10.34 possibly , guess you need to find out yourself , but I believe the initial firmware (Icom-Restore.bin) will works .

RE: Progman32 install/setup for icom? Nativ?
I do it on a another way...

Ediabas.ini

Remote
169.254.92.38
6801

Vmware vnet2
169.254.92.38
255.255.0.0
169.254.92.1 - 169.254.92.40

Progman32
169.254.92.38

Works very fast!

Start ediabas and ifhserv
